Sticky Chicken Rice Bowls: The Best Easy Recipe for Dinner
Enjoy a quick and delicious dinner with these Sticky Chicken Rice Bowls that are perfect for busy weeknights.

- 2 cups rice
- 1 pound chicken thighs
- 1/4 cup soy sauce
- 2 tablespoons honey
- 1 tablespoon sesame oil
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 teaspoon ginger, grated
- 2 green onions, chopped
- 1 cup mixed vegetables
- Cook the rice according to package instructions.
- In a bowl, mix soy sauce, honey, sesame oil, garlic, and ginger.
- Marinate the chicken thighs in the sauce for at least 30 minutes.
- Heat a skillet over medium heat and cook the marinated chicken until fully cooked.
- Add mixed vegetables to the skillet and stir-fry for a few minutes.
- Serve the sticky chicken over rice and garnish with green onions.
Notes
- Serve with extra soy sauce for dipping.
- Can substitute chicken with tofu for a vegetarian option.
